الفرق بين المصمم والمطور: من يصمم ومن يبرمج؟

الفرق بين المصمم والمطور: من يصمم ومن يبرمج؟
الفرق بين المصمم والمطور: من يصمم ومن يبرمج؟


كثير من الناس يخلطون بين مصمم المواقع (Web Designer) ومطور المواقع (Web Developer). رغم أنهم يشتغلون في نفس المجال، إلا أن كل واحد له أسلوب وأدوات مختلفة تمامًا. تخيل إنك تبغى تبني بيت: المصمم هو اللي يرسم المخطط ويحدد الألوان، والمطور هو اللي يبني البيت فعليًا. بنفس الفكرة في عالم الويب — المصمم يبتكر الشكل والتجربة، والمطور يحولها إلى موقع حقيقي يعمل بكفاءة.

👨‍🎨 أولًا: من هو مصمم المواقع؟

مصمم المواقع هو الشخص اللي يهتم بالمظهر البصري وتجربة المستخدم. هدفه إنه يخلي الموقع جميل وسهل الاستخدام. هو الفنان في الفريق — عنده حس بالألوان، الخطوط، التباعد، والتوازن بين العناصر.

مهام المصمم:

  • تصميم واجهة المستخدم (UI) من أزرار، قوائم وصور.
  • تحسين تجربة المستخدم (UX) لتكون مريحة وسلسة.
  • اختيار الألوان والخطوط اللي تعكس هوية المشروع.
  • تصميم النماذج الأولية باستخدام أدوات مثل Figma وAdobe XD.
  • التعاون مع المطورين لتطبيق التصميم بدقة.

مهارات المصمم:

  • الإبداع والذوق الفني.
  • فهم سيكولوجية المستخدم.
  • القدرة على استخدام أدوات التصميم الحديثة.
  • الاهتمام بأدق التفاصيل.

المصمم يهتم بالسؤال: كيف يبدو الموقع؟ 👀


👨‍💻 ثانيًا: من هو مطور المواقع؟

المطور هو الشخص اللي يبني الموقع فعليًا باستخدام الأكواد. هو المسؤول عن تشغيل كل شيء خلف الكواليس وتحويل التصميم إلى موقع تفاعلي.

أنواع المطورين:

  • Frontend Developer: يتعامل مع الواجهة الأمامية، أي الجزء اللي يراه المستخدم، باستخدام لغات مثل HTML وCSS وJavaScript.
  • Backend Developer: يتعامل مع الخوادم وقواعد البيانات باستخدام لغات مثل Python أو PHP.
  • Full Stack Developer: يجمع بين الاثنين، ويفهم التصميم والبرمجة معًا.

مهام المطور:

  • تحويل التصميم إلى صفحات ويب حية.
  • برمجة التفاعلات والوظائف.
  • تحسين أداء الموقع وسرعته.
  • ضمان التوافق مع جميع الأجهزة.
  • إصلاح الأخطاء وحماية الموقع من الثغرات.

المطور يجاوب على السؤال: كيف يعمل الموقع؟ ⚙️


⚖️ الفرق بين المصمم والمطور

الجانب المصمم المطور
الهدف جمال وتجربة المستخدم الوظيفة والأداء
الأدوات Figma، Adobe XD، Canva VS Code، GitHub، Node.js
طريقة التفكير بصرية وإبداعية منطقية وتحليلية
لغة العمل ألوان وخطوط وتفاعل أكواد وأوامر

🤝 كيف يشتغلون مع بعض؟

العلاقة بين المصمم والمطور مثل التناغم بين العقل والعين. المصمم يبتكر الشكل، والمطور ينفذه. التعاون بينهم ضروري جدًا عشان الموقع يطلع جميل وفعّال بنفس الوقت.

  1. المصمم يجهز النموذج (Prototype).
  2. المطور يحوله إلى موقع حقيقي.
  3. يختبرون التجربة معًا.
  4. يعدلون حسب ملاحظات المستخدمين.

بدون المصمم، الموقع يفتقد الجمال. وبدون المطور، التصميم يبقى مجرد صورة.


🧠 أدوات التعاون بين المصمم والمطور

  • Figma + Zeplin: لتبادل التصميم بدقة.
  • GitHub: لإدارة الأكواد ومشاركة الملفات.
  • Trello / Notion: لتنظيم العمل.
  • Slack: للتواصل الفوري بين الفريق.

🚀 كيف تختار مسارك؟

اسأل نفسك: هل تحب الفن والإبداع؟ أو تحب البرمجة والمنطق؟

  • لو تميل للجماليات والتصميم — ابدأ كمصمم.
  • لو تحب الأكواد والمنطق — ابدأ كمطور.
  • ولو تحب الاثنين — خذ مسار Full Stack أو Product Designer.

المهارة الحقيقية إنك تفهم لغة الطرف الآخر، لأن المصمم اللي يعرف كود بسيط، والمطور اللي عنده ذوق تصميمي، هم الأفضل في السوق.


🧭 المستقبل: الذكاء الاصطناعي يدخل اللعبة

الذكاء الاصطناعي بدأ يغير قواعد اللعبة. أدوات مثل Framer AI تصمم مواقع تلقائيًا، وGitHub Copilot يساعد المبرمجين في كتابة الأكواد. لكن يبقى العنصر البشري هو الأهم — الذكاء الاصطناعي ما يعرف الإبداع والذوق مثل الإنسان.


🏁 الخلاصة

المصمم هو العين، والمطور هو العقل. الأول يهتم بالجمال، والثاني يهتم بالوظيفة. وإذا اشتغلوا مع بعض بتناغم، النتيجة موقع يخطف النظر ويشتغل بسلاسة.

فلا تسأل "من أهم؟" — لأن الاثنين وجهان لعملة واحدة. التصميم بدون برمجة مجرد صورة، والبرمجة بدون تصميم مجرد كود بارد. أما الجمال الحقيقي؟ فهو لما يجتمع الفن والعلم في صفحة ويب واحدة.